Slut Tape: where can I get some
Years ago I used a product called "Slug Tape" (IIRC)
to minimise the slugs and snails had on my plants. (N.B. it isn't the adhesive copper tape.) I can't find any now, and I'm wondering where I can get it. Slug Tape was a 1cm wide strip of paper impregnated with metaldehyde. When layed across a "slug highway", it was extremely effective at preventing them getting near my plants. Alternatively, putting a loop around a stem protected that individual plants. It was effective for a surprisingly long time, surviving several showers or a burst of heavy rain. Since it was paper, birds etc didn't eat it, unlike the blue granules. Currently I'm making an alternative by painting a thick metaldehyde paste onto toilet roll cardboard types. It works, but I'm lazy. So does anybody know - who made it? - where I can get some from? - any alternatives? Thanks! |
